So zeigen Sie geöffnete Dateien auf einer Netzwerkfreigabe auf einem Windows-Server an

Windows Server 2022Windows Server 2025

In diesem Tutorial erkläre ich, wie Sie von einem Windows-Server aus sehen, welche freigegebenen Dateien und Ordner geöffnet sind.

Es gibt zwei Möglichkeiten, auf die Ansicht geöffneter Dateien und Ordner zuzugreifen: im grafischen Modus oder in der Befehlszeile mit PowerShell.

Anzeigen geöffneter Dateien und Ordner mit PowerShell

Auflisten geöffneter Ordner und Dateien mit dem PowerShell-Cmdlet Get-SmbOpenFile :

Get-SmbOpenFile

Ergebnis :

FileId       SessionId    Path                      ShareRelativePath ClientComputerName ClientUserName
------       ---------    ----                      ----------------- ------------------ --------------
122675006077 122876330697 C:windowsSYSVOLsysvol                   10.0.0.50          LABAdministrateur

Details zu einer Datei:

Get-SmbOpenFile -FileId <!ID-FICHIER!> | Select-Objet -Property *

Ergebnis : 

SmbInstance           : Default
ClientComputerName    : 10.0.0.50
ClientUserName        : LABAdministrateur
ClusterNodeName       :
ContinuouslyAvailable : False
Encrypted             : False
FileId                : 122675006077
Locks                 : 0
Path                  : C:windowsSYSVOLsysvol
Permissions           : 1048705
ScopeName             : *
SessionId             : 122876330697
ShareRelativePath     :
Signed                : True
PSComputerName        :
CimClass              : ROOT/Microsoft/Windows/SMB : MSFT_SmbOpenFile
CimInstanceProperties : {ClientComputerName, ClientUserName, ClusterNodeName, ContinuouslyAvailable...}
CimSystemProperties   : Microsoft.Management.Infrastructure.CimSystemProperties

Filtern Sie die Liste der geöffneten Dateien:

Get-SmbOpenFile | Where-Object -Property ShareRelativePath -Match ".vhdx"

Der obige Befehl zeigt nur VHDX-Dateien an

Schließen Sie eine geöffnete Datei:

Close-SmbOpenFile -FileId <!FILE-ID!>

Ergebnis: Bestätigen Sie die Aktion.

Confirmer
Êtes-vous sûr de vouloir effectuer cette action ?
Opération « Close-File » en cours sur la cible « 122675006077 ».
[O] Oui  [T] Oui pour tout  [N] Non  [U] Non pour tout  [S] Suspendre  [?] Aide (la valeur par défaut est « O ») : O

Zeigen Sie geöffnete Dateien und Ordner über die GUI an

Öffnen Sie den lokalen Computer-Manager.

Gehen Sie zu „Freigegebene Ordner“ 1.

Dieser Ordner enthält 3 Unterordner:

  • Freigaben: Ermöglicht die Anzeige der Liste der auf dem Server verfügbaren Freigaben sowie die Verwaltung (Hinzufügen / Ändern / Löschen).
  • Sitzungen: Zeigt die Liste der Benutzer an, die Zugriff auf freigegebene Elemente haben
  • Geöffnete Dateien: Zeigt die Liste der geöffneten Dateien an.

Gehen Sie zum Ordner „Geöffnete Dateien“ 1, um die geöffneten Dateien anzuzeigen.

File open

Um den Zugriff auf die Datei zu schließen, klicken Sie mit der rechten Maustaste auf die Datei und dann auf „Geöffnete Datei schließen“.

Gehen Sie zum Ordner „Sitzungen 1“. Auf dieser Seite werden die am Computer angemeldeten Benutzer und die Anzahl der geöffneten Dateien angezeigt.

Sessions

Wie bei Dateien können Sie auch bei Sitzungen Aktionen ausführen, indem Sie mit der rechten Maustaste auf den Ordner klicken.

Romain Drouche
Systemarchitekt | MCSE: Kerninfrastruktur
IT-Infrastrukturexperte mit über 15 Jahren Berufserfahrung. Aktuell tätig als Projektmanager für Systeme und Netzwerke sowie als Experte für Informationssystemsicherheit, nutze ich mein Fachwissen, um die Zuverlässigkeit und Sicherheit technologischer Umgebungen zu gewährleisten.

Schreibe einen Kommentar